We are working with a global Software, Systems & Engineering company in the Defence Sector, supporting them with appointing an Antenna Electromagnetic Engineer. You will play a key role in developing and modelling antennas and electromagnetic systems that support both defence and commercial applications, helping to advance innovative technologies and programmes. Day-to-day, you’ll be part of the Electromagnetics Group within the Advanced Materials and Devices team, supporting technical leads, managing your own workload, running work packages, and contributing to ongoing projects across the Company’s defence and commercial portfolios. You will work autonomously day-to-day, while also being an active member of the team.

Salary: £50-55k per annum + benefits

Location: Farnborough - hybrid (3 days per week onsite; 2 days WFH)

Working hours: 37 per week

Duration: perm, full time

Requirements: sole UK nationals or dual nationals


Responsibilities

* Development of novel antennas and related systems for civil and defence applications
* Electromagnetic (EM) modelling of complex EM interactions on internal and external programmes
* Providing advice to internal and external customers on EM modelling and design
* Supporting the delivery of key programmes relating to antennas, communications, and sensing systems
* Participating in bid development and contributing to technical proposals
* Working across the Company to deliver holistic solutions


Essential Experience

* Interest in meta-materials and antenna functionality, with any practical exposure to RF seen as a bonus
* Familiarity with CST / HFSS or a willingness to develop skills in modelling and simulation tools
* Some understanding of PCB or circuit board integration, or experience working alongside those who do
* Comfortable organising your own workload and supporting others in the team where needed
* Able to work independently and also contribute well within a collaborative group


Essential Qualifications

* Degree in Physics, Electrical Engineering, or a related technical field
* Knowledge of contemporary antenna theory
* Understanding of electromagnetic metamaterials and modelling
* Awareness of EM measurement techniques
